0% found this document useful (0 votes)
4 views4 pages

2736385-DDL and Data Files

The document outlines the creation of various tables in the CHINOOK_DATA database, including CUSTOMER, ALBUM, ARTIST, EMPLOYEE, INVOICE, INVOICELINE, GENRE, PLAYLIST, PLAYLISTTRACK, and TRACK. Each table is defined with specific fields and data types, such as NUMBER and VARCHAR, to store relevant information. This structure is designed to support a music-related data management system.

Uploaded by

Kumar Satti
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
4 views4 pages

2736385-DDL and Data Files

The document outlines the creation of various tables in the CHINOOK_DATA database, including CUSTOMER, ALBUM, ARTIST, EMPLOYEE, INVOICE, INVOICELINE, GENRE, PLAYLIST, PLAYLISTTRACK, and TRACK. Each table is defined with specific fields and data types, such as NUMBER and VARCHAR, to store relevant information. This structure is designed to support a music-related data management system.

Uploaded by

Kumar Satti
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
You are on page 1/ 4

Data Files:

create or replace TABLE CHINOOK_DATA.CUSTOMERS (

CUSTOMERID NUMBER(38,0),

FIRSTNAME VARCHAR(200),

LASTNAME VARCHAR(200),

COMPANY VARCHAR(200),

ADDRESS VARCHAR(5000),

CITY VARCHAR(200),

STATE VARCHAR(200),

COUNTRY VARCHAR(100),

POSTALCODE VARCHAR(200),

PHONE VARCHAR(200),

FAX VARCHAR(100),

EMAIL VARCHAR(50),

SUPPORTREPID NUMBER(38,0)

);

create or replace TABLE CHINOOK_DATA.ALBUM (

ALBUMID NUMBER(38,0),

TITLE VARCHAR(500),

ARTISTID NUMBER(38,0)

);
create or replace TABLE CHINOOK_DATA.ARTIST (

ARTISTID NUMBER(38,0),

NAME VARCHAR(200)

);

create or replace TABLE CHINOOK_DATA.EMPLOYEE (

EMPLOYEEID NUMBER(38,0),

LASTNAME VARCHAR(100),

FIRSTNAME VARCHAR(100),

TITLE VARCHAR(200),

REPORTSTO VARCHAR(100),

BIRTHDATE DATE,

HIREDATE DATE,

ADDRESS VARCHAR(1000),

CITY VARCHAR(100),

STATE VARCHAR(100),

COUNTRY VARCHAR(100),

POSTALCODE VARCHAR(100),

PHONE VARCHAR(100),

FAX VARCHAR(100),

EMAIL VARCHAR(100)

);

create or replace TABLE CHINOOK_DATA.INVOICE (

INVOICEID NUMBER(38,0),

CUSTOMERID NUMBER(38,0),

INVOICEDATE DATE,

BILLINGADDRESS VARCHAR(1000),
BILLINGCITY VARCHAR(100),

BILLINGSTATE VARCHAR(100),

BILLINGCOUNTRY VARCHAR(100),

BILLINGPOSTALCODE VARCHAR(100),

TOTAL NUMBER(38,5)

);

create or replace TABLE CHINOOK_DATA.INVOICELINE (

INVOICELINEID NUMBER(38,0),

INVOICEID NUMBER(38,0),

TRACKID NUMBER(38,0),

UNITPRICE NUMBER(38,5),

QUANTITY NUMBER(38,0)

);

create or replace TABLE CHINOOK_DATA.GENRE (

GENREID NUMBER(38,0),

NAME VARCHAR(350)

);

create or replace TABLE CHINOOK_DATA.PLAYLIST (

PLAYLISTID NUMBER(38,0),

NAME VARCHAR(100)

);

create or replace TABLE CHINOOK_DATA.PLAYLISTTRACK (

PLAYLISTID NUMBER(38,0),

TRACKID NUMBER(38,0)

);
create or replace TABLE CHINOOK_DATA.TRACK (

TRACKID NUMBER(38,0),

NAME VARCHAR(500),

ALBUMID NUMBER(38,0),

MEDIATYPEID NUMBER(38,0),

GENREID NUMBER(38,0),

COMPOSER VARCHAR(500),

MILLISECONDS NUMBER(38,0),

BYTES NUMBER(38,0),

UNITPRICE NUMBER(38,5)

);

You might also like